To comprehensively evaluate the experience of interaction between humans and ECAs (Embodied Conversational Agents), it is essential to consider a complex entanglement of dimensions that dynamically develop over time. This paper provides a review of the available methods to evaluate the human-ECAs interaction, and discusses the relation between this experience of use over time. The research was carried out through a systematic literature review, on 5 databases: Scopus, ACM,Web of Science, PubMed and IEEE Xplore. Findings reveal that over 147 publications on human-ECAS interaction, only 13 address the experience evaluation. Of these, only 3 face evaluate the user experience with ECAs over time. The majority of these evaluation methods concentrate on momentary experiences, neglecting the long-term perspective. The paper provides a map of methods to evaluate several user experience dimensions of interactions with ECAs, highlighting the importance to apply these methods not only on the momentary interaction but repeatedly over time.
